About the Role
We are looking for a senior Linux Infrastructure Engineer to build and optimise latency-sensitive trading infrastructure, with a strong focus on bare-metal Linux, low-latency networking and exchange connectivity.
The role also includes supporting AWS infrastructure, automation and connectivity across colocated and cloud environments.
Responsibilities
- Design, deploy, optimise and maintain bare-metal Linux infrastructure for latency-sensitive trading systems that handle market data, strategy, alpha, order management and execution.
- Specify and validate hardware choices: processors, memory, storage, and network interfaces.
- Profile and tune OS components such as BIOS, CPU & IRQ affinity, NUMA node selection, huge pages, power management, NIC configuration and relevant kernel parameters for predictable performance.
- Establish secure configuration and appropriate patch-management processes.
- Networking & Colocation
- Own deployments in exchange colocation environments such as Equinix LD4.
- Coordinate with providers, exchanges and remote-hands teams to provision rack space, power, server and network hardware, cross-connects, and global private transport.
- Configure internal segmentation and management networks, and coordinate provider handoff requirements such as VLAN tags, port settings, and routing.
- Troubleshoot TCP/IP and UDP connectivity and investigate latency, jitter, packet loss and other performance issues.
- Ensure accurate time synchronization and packet timestamping with PTP and NIC hardware clocks.
- Design and maintain exchange-facing, latency-sensitive AWS infrastructure including instance selection and placement, enhanced networking, VPC design, packet-level monitoring, and latency diagnostics.
- Support staging, research, operations and testing workloads that rely on services such as Sage Maker, EC2, S3 and Code Artifact.
- Automate reproducible provisioning, deployment and configuration tasks with Terraform, Git Hub Actions, AWS Systems Manager, systemd, cloud-init, Python and Bash.
- Implement connectivity between cloud and colocated workloads with AWS Direct Connect or equivalent services.
- System Reliability
- Monitor the health, performance, and availability of our infrastructure, proactively reporting and resolving incidents.
- Develop operational documentation, runbooks, monitoring, alerting, logging, backup, and disaster-recovery processes.
- Work closely with software engineers, quantitative developers, and traders to improve system performance, reliability and ergonomics.
